Proportion Of Establishments Offering Employees' Choice Of Days Off/Shift Swapping/Time Banking/Flexi-Shift - Industry (Level 2)

Description

Ministry of Manpower CSV on the share of Singapore establishments offering employees’ choice of days off, shift swapping, time banking, or flexi-shift, by Level 2 industry for mid-year periods from 2022 through 2025. Covers private establishments with at least 25 employees and the public sector. HR and labour-policy analysts compare scheduled FWA uptake across detailed industries.

Official description

Source: Conditions of Employment Survey, Manpower Research and Statistics Department, MOM Notes: (1) For the years in which the Conditions of Employment Survey (i.e., 2023 and 2025) was not conducted, data on flexible work arrangements are obtained from a MOM Supplementary Survey. (2) Data pertain to private sector establishments each with at least 25 employees and the public sector. (3) Data pertain to permanent employees and employees on term contract of at least one year. (4) Figures refer to establishments offering the respective types of scheduled flexible work arrangements as a proportion of all establishments. (5) 'n.a.': Data were not collected for the year.
